Job Description

The Urgent Crisis Response Team (CRT) is a multi-disciplinary team that supports patients at home either when in a crisis to prevent an ED attendance, thus a hospital admission or to support early discharge allowing patients to get the care they need at home safely and conveniently, rather than being in hospital.

The service has the ability to clinically monitor patients remotely using enhanced technology and a highly skilled clinical team that can respond within 2 hours.

The team comprises of Advanced Clinical Practitioners, Senior Nurses Occupational Therapists, Physiotherapists, Social Workers, a Pharmacist and Senior Support Workers.

The role of the Senior Therapist within the service is to work collaboratively with other team members offering holistic assessments for patients who may be in a crisis situation. There is a strong element of “see and treat” management within the therapy role in the community setting.
